blockly > Events (Sự kiện) > BlockDelete (Xoá khối)

Lớp Events.BlockDelete

Thông báo cho trình nghe khi một khối (hoặc ngăn xếp khối được kết nối) bị xoá.

Chữ ký:

export declare class BlockDelete extends BlockBase 

Mở rộng: BlockBase

Hàm khởi tạo

Hàm dựng Đối tượng sửa đổi Mô tả
(constructor)(opt_block) Tạo một thực thể mới của lớp BlockDelete

Thuộc tính

Thuộc tính Đối tượng sửa đổi Loại Mô tả
mã nhận dạng? string[] (Không bắt buộc) Tất cả mã nhận dạng của các khối đã xoá.
oldJson? blocks.State (Không bắt buộc) Nội dung JSON đại diện cho(các) khối đã xoá.
oldXml? Phần tử | DocumentFragment (Không bắt buộc) Nội dung XML thể hiện(các) khối đã xoá.
type EventType
wasShadow? boolean (Không bắt buộc) Đúng nếu khối đã xoá là khối bóng đổ, sai nếu không phải.

Phương thức

Phương thức Đối tượng sửa đổi Mô tả
run(forward) Chạy một sự kiện xoá.
toJson() Mã hoá sự kiện dưới dạng JSON.